Atrioesophageal fistula (AEF) is a potentially lethal complication of catheter radiofrequency ablation for atrial fibrillation. A 49-year-old man with paroxysmal atrial fibrillation who underwent catheter ablation around the pulmonary vein was admitted 31 days after the procedure, suffering seizures and fever. Magnetic resonance imaging of the brain showed ischemia and multiple lesions of acute infarction in the right occipital lobe of the cerebrum. Computed tomography (CT) of the chest showed a small accumulation of air between the posterior left atrium and the esophagus, suggesting an AEF. Endoscopic snaring of the esophageal mucosa, repeated a few times, supported by nil by mouth and antibiotic therapy, resulted in improvement of his condition with no recurrence of symptoms. Subsequent chest CT scans confirmed disappearance of the leaked air and the patient was discharged home 45 days after admission with no neurological compromise.

An 82-year-old woman, who underwent axillo-bifemoral bypass for infrarenal aortic occlusion and peripheral arterial occlusive disease 9 years before, was admitted to our hospital for swelling in the left subclavicular region. Ultrasound examination revealed a leak in the wall of the bypass graft with the formation of a false aneurysm. No signs of infection, either locally or systemically, were observed. Resection of the aneurismal segment with interposition using a Dacron graft was performed. Macroscopic findings during surgery confirmed an intact anastomotic region of the left axillary artery and Dacron graft. Two possible mechanisms for the formation of this false aneurysm, either cumulative stress on the graft over the years or Dacron graft biodegradation, were hypothesized.
